Salmonella outbreak claims third life
Arizona's state and local health investigators have now identified 85 total cases of Salmonella Poona in the state, including 16 in Pima County, where one woman has died as a result of the infection. There have been two other deaths — one in California and one in Texas — connected to the outbreak.
Former peanut executive receives long prison term in Salmonella case
The former owner of Peanut Corp. of America was sentenced to 28 years in prison for his role in a 2008 Salmonella outbreak that claimed nine lives and sickened 714 across 46 states.
Stewart Parnell, 61, was convicted in 2014 on 72 counts of fraud, conspiracy and introducing adulterated food into interstate commerce. His sentencing on Sept. 21 represents the longest prison term ever levied upon an executive in a food poisoning case.
Sens. Stabenow, Perdue to address nutrition, immigration reform at United Fresh
Sens. Debbie Stabenow (D-MI) and David Perdue (R-GA) will address over 500 produce industry executives on Congress’s efforts tackling child nutrition reauthorization, implementing the 2014 farm bill and reforming immigration policies, during the general session breakfast on Wednesday, Sept. 30 at the United Fresh 2015 Washington Conference.
Marsh Supermarkets partnership a boon for in-state produce
Marsh Supermarkets has been named as a major in-store retail partner for the Indiana Grown Initiative. The partnership will continue to make it easier to identify, find and purchase locally sourced products with the launch of 50 kiosks selling 100 Indiana Grown products in Marsh stores throughout Indiana.

Atlas Produce adds to date volume
Atlas Produce & Distribution Inc., located in Bakersfield, CA, is expecting its volume of California dates to be up about 20 percent this year, which includes a significant jump in its organic date volume.
Generational know-how characterizes operations at Sun-Glo
The warehouse began to bustle on Aug. 18 for Sun-Glo of Idaho Inc., headquartered in Sugar City, ID. The company, initially established by five southeast Idaho potato growers in 1974, has been solely owned by the Crapo family since 1999. The family has produced quality Idaho potatoes for four generations.
Stemilt’s Piñata apple stars at Meet the Grower dinner
Stemilt’s signature apple variety, Piñata, was the star ingredient on Seattle chef Ericka Burke’s menu during Stemilt’s first-ever Meet the Grower blogger dinner held on Sept. 17 at Beecher’s Loft overlooking Pike Place Market and the waterfront in Seattle.
